April 3rd, 2018

Thrillist.com: The Best Towns in America to Visit UFOs

“You know those grainy black-and-white pictures you see on B-rolls of every TV show you’ve ever seen about flying saucers? There’s a good chance those photos came from McMinnville, a small town in the heart of Oregon wine country that’s known just as well for its UFOs as its pinot noir.”

Check out the full article here!